In 2016, Shirin received her B.A. in Cinema and Television Arts with an emphasis in Screenwriting and minor in Business Management from California State University, Northridge. While Shirin was a student, she worked on campus at the University Student Union as an Event Planner for events like CARNAVAL, an all-day multicultural event to celebrate international culture, cuisine, art, music, and more, and assisted the CSUN A.S. partners to help promote CSUN’s Big Show featuring Afrojack.
Shirin’s first official job after college was working with Insomniac Events as a Ground Control Responder Team Lead, where she oversaw safety of 400,000+ patrons by supporting Health & Safety with medical issues, and worked directly with local Law Enforcement teams to ensure attendees were safe, happy, healthy, and hydrated at Electric Daisy Carnaval Las Vegas in 2016. She then went on to work in Customer Experience and Ticketing at smaller shows like Bassrush events at NOS Events Center in San Bernardino and Countdown NYE in Downtown Los Angeles.
After that, Shirin worked a plethora of jobs in entertainment at AwesomenessTV and with their partners. The coolest true story she now gets to say from those work experiences is that she accidentally hung up the phone on Kate Hudson.
Since 2024, Shirin has been pursuing her M.S. in Digital Media Management from University of Southern California.
